The Trump DOJ sued California over its new congressional map, alleging racial gerrymandering and partisan bias.
The Trump-era Justice Department has sued California over its newly adopted congressional map under Proposition 50, arguing it violates the Voting Rights Act and the 14th Amendment by using race to strengthen Hispanic voting power and lock in Democratic gains.
California Republicans and 19 voters joined the lawsuit, calling the map a partisan power grab.
State officials, including Governor Gavin Newsom, rejected the claims and said the map complies with federal law and counters Republican attempts to secure political advantage elsewhere.
The case could affect the 2026 midterms and underscores escalating national battles over redistricting and voting rights.
